Earlier this morning (April 27), popular Tamil filmmaker Thamira passed away due to Covid 19 complications and his unfortunate demise has shocked the entire Tamil film industry. He was 53 years old when he breathed his last. Thamira was known for his feel good emotional family dramas. He made his directorial debut with the film, Rettaisuzhi that starred veteran directors K Balachander and Bharathiraja in the lead roles. Later, Thamira directed Aan Devathai which featured Samuthirakani and Bigg Boss sensation Ramya Pandian in the lead roles. The film was appreciated by the critics for its interestingly written premise.
